The lighting of torch, sign of start) During the first week of class after our Christmas break, our PE teacher announced that we would be performing at the SCUAA 2025 games. For those unfamiliar,SCUAA stands for State Colleges and University Athletic Association.This association comprises seven institutions from various state universities and colleges: Bohol Island State University (BISU), Negros Oriental State University (NORSU), Siquijor State College (SSC), Philippine State College of Aeronautics (PHILSCA), University of the Philippines Cebu (UP), Cebu Technological University (CTU), and Cebu Normal University (CNU),the host of SCUAA 2025.

At first, we complained about being selected as performers on such short notice, especially since it was the peak of Sinulog in Cebu. Sinulog usually results in class cancellations, and students are still recovering from the festival. Our rest were also extended until January 23rd due to online learning, and meaning rehearsals and prop-making only began on January 23rd. The start was incredibly challenging due to the late notice. We received the necessary materials for the field demonstration on January 22nd as well, forcing us to rush the acquisition of bamboo sticks, styrofoam balls, crepe paper, cartolina, fairy lights, lumber, fabric for the wings and flag and cardboard for the box.

Our choreographer and physical education teachers allowed us just two days for practice, leading to a hectic flurry of rehearsals and prop creation. The practice venue, the Abellana Cebu City Complex, resembled a furnace. Positioned in the middle of an oval, we experienced the unyielding midday sun. Even though we used long-sleeved jackets and trousers, and sunscreen, the heat was intolerable; sweat continuously streamed down to our faces.

We were concerned about the outcome of our field demonstration. With 1,400 students and a comparatively small stage, the area was extremely packed. It would be almost unfeasible for our choreographer to readily notice errors committed by the dancers and prop handlers. To tackle this issue, they established a two-part training timetable. Initially, the performers practiced their routines. Subsequently, the prop handlers understood their roles and movements, synchronizing their actions with the dancers' performance on the stage.
